Mojang Studios Ends Development for Minecraft Legends After Less Than a Year

Mojang Studios announced that the development for Minecraft Legends has officially ended, only less than a year after the game was released. 

The Minecraft spin-off was launched last April 2023 under Mojang's owner, Microsoft.

Minecraft Legends Developers Step Back From Development

In a blog post, senior creative writer at Mojang Studios, Cristina Anderca revealed that the studio had been gathering and implementing feedback from the community. She cited that it is already complete and the team is now going to "take a step back from development." 

In line with the announcement, the team unveiled a last freebie for gamers which is the Bright-Eyed Hero skin. The freebie is now available to claim on Minecraft Legends Marketplace. 

In addition, the Lost Legends challenges will remain available for free and players can still earn rewards from their victory. The technical support, functionalities, and all features from the game will still be available but there will be no new content anymore. 

Mojang Hints More Minecraft Universe 

Despite its short development era, Mojang Studios promised that it would continue to explore and bring new experiences to the Minecraft universe. Hence, players can still continue to watch out for upcoming spin-off games like Minecraft Legends

"Together, we united the Overworld, made some adorably scary friends, and most importantly, showed those piglins that they messed with the wrong dimension, again and again," the company wrote. 

Last year, Mojang also announced the end of development for the Minecraft Dungeons after the game achieved over 25 million players.
